Replacement-Doors-300x200.jpgInstallation Costs

The cost to install a cat flap varies greatly dependent on the type, size, and complexity of the project. It is also important to take into consideration the door or wall material since this will impact labor costs. For instance, installing into a glass French door will likely cost more than installation into the wooden door.

It is recommended that you hire a tradesperson who has been thoroughly screened for the job. This will ensure that the task is done properly and that your pet is secure. It might cost a bit more to hire an expert, but it will save you time and money in the long run. Additionally, a professional will be able to advise you on the best type of cat flap for your home.

There are many kinds of cat flaps on the market, from simple manual flaps to microchip-enabled flaps. It is essential to choose the right one for your pet and your home, since it will determine how simple and comfortable your pet will be to use the flap. It is also essential to take measurements of your pet's size, to ensure the flap will fit them comfortably.

Once the cat flap has been installed, it is crucial to give your pet a few days to adjust to it. This will help them to feel secure and comfortable at home which is essential for their mental well-being. Open and close the door often so that your pet becomes accustomed to new sensations.

Make sure the flap is placed at a level that is comfortable for your pet. If it is too low your cat may struggle to use it and may be injured in the process. The ideal position for the flap is to have it at the top. the flap should be at least one inch taller than the back of your cat's.

Additional Costs

It is important to be aware of any additional charges in the installation process when you purchase the latest cat flap for your home. This could include the cost of the cat flap, as in the labor and the materials needed to put it up it. The kind of pet flap you choose will also affect the price of your project. Higher-end models cost more than cheaper and simpler ones.

There are a variety of different kinds of dog and cat flaps that are available each with its own unique set of features. For instance, microchip-operated cats flaps are made to recognize your pet's microchip and prevent other neighbourhood cats from entering your home. These flaps for dogs and cats are more expensive than traditional pet flaps, however they can provide peace of mind and greater security for your home.

When selecting the right dog or cat flap, it's important to think about the dimensions of your pet as well as the material that your wall or door is constructed from. Some surfaces are more pliable to cut than others, and this may impact the overall cost of the project.

A skilled tradesperson will be able solve the difficulties of installing a cat flap in various types of doors and walls. This will save you time and money, while also ensuring that the work is done correctly.

Many homeowners try to install a cat flap by themselves but it can be challenging and risky. A professional who has been vetted will ensure that the flap is installed correctly and safely, thus avoiding injury or damage to your pet.

Materials

A cat flap is a small opening in the window, door or wall that allows your pet to come and go whenever they like. These cat flaps are available in a variety of sizes, styles, and materials that will fit into any home and budget. There are also different security options, such as magnetic, electronic, and microchip. Each option offers its own distinct advantages and advantages, however they all require different installation methods.

Before you install a cat flap, first take a measurement of the belly height of your cat. This is the measurement from the bottom of their stomach to the floor. This will aid you in deciding which place to put the flap inside the door. Take the height twice to ensure you have an accurate measurement. Then utilize a spirit level to make sure that the line is straight. The template that comes with the kit can be used to mark the hole in the door.

If you are using a microchip or magnetic cat flap, make sure that you program the collar tags or microchip of your cat prior to installing the flap. This will ensure that only your cat will be able to enter and prevents neighbouring cats from gaining access to your house. Then, screw the fixing bolts into place and apply any sealant which is suggested by the cat flap manufacturer.

After the fixing bolts have been installed, slide the inside section of the flap into position. Then align it with the line that you sketched earlier. Push each bolt through the hole on the outer section of flap and then screw on the nuts. Once everything is screwed in using a spirit level, check to make sure it's flush and then sand the edges of the flap.

Time

Making precise measurements and using the appropriate tools prior to beginning the work will ensure that the cat flap is properly installed. The instructions included with the cat flap you choose should outline which sections are where, and if there are any additional tools needed. The wall or door can also determine the ease or difficulty it is to put in. Certain materials require more sophisticated tools than other.

After the wall or door has been prepared, the installation process can begin. The installation process can last from one to three hour depending on the complexity and requirements of the cat flap installers near me flap. At this point the flap you choose is secured to the door or wall and any final adjustments are made. This may include calibrating the microchip on the flap (if you've selected a model that is microchip-enabled) or checking that the flap opens/closes correctly for your cat.

It's essential that your cat adjusts to the flap once it's been installed. It could take a few weeks or even several days for your cat's to feel at ease with the flap. In the meantime you can make use of treats or how Much To install a cat flap other positive reinforcement methods to motivate them to use the flap, and you can always close it during bad weather or when you don't want them out.
